Dain E. Vines, M.D.
Dr. Vines, a native of Greensboro, NC, completed his undergraduate education at NC State University, majoring in Zoology (minor in Genetics). He completed his medical training at UNC, specializing in Family Medicine and remains on faculty as an Adjunct Professor. He has cared for patients in Orange County for over 20 years. He is married with two young adult children. Dr. Vines is very pleased to be working in Hillsborough. As owner, his philosophy is to provide his patients with a medical home that feels like an extension of their family.
Dr. Vines, a native of Greensboro, NC, completed his undergraduate education at NC State University, majoring in Zoology (minor in Genetics). He completed his medical training at UNC, specializing in Family Medicine and remains on faculty as an Adjunct Professor. He has cared for patients in Orange County for over 20 years. He is married with two young adult children. Dr. Vines is very pleased to be working in Hillsborough. As owner, his philosophy is to provide his patients with a medical home that feels like an extension of their family.